如何使用SpringBoot和MySQL搭建一个完整的智慧党建系统?请分享相关的开发环境搭建、关键代码实现以及系统部署的详细步骤。
时间: 2024-11-04 13:17:08 浏览: 22
要构建一个基于SpringBoot和MySQL的智慧党建系统,首先需要掌握SpringBoot框架和MySQL数据库的相关知识。接下来,可以参考《Springboot和Mysql实现的智慧党建系统源码教程》来详细了解整个系统的构建流程。
参考资源链接:[Springboot和Mysql实现的智慧党建系统源码教程](https://wenku.csdn.net/doc/7dsm44j0jx?spm=1055.2569.3001.10343)
开发环境搭建:
1. 安装Java开发环境(如JDK)。
2. 安装IDE工具,推荐使用IntelliJ IDEA或Eclipse,并配置好相应的开发环境。
3. 安装MySQL数据库,并创建数据库实例,导入初始数据。
4. 使用Maven进行项目管理,确保项目的pom.xml配置正确。
5. 设置IDE中的数据库连接以及数据库驱动依赖。
关键代码实现:
1. 根据系统需求定义实体类(Entity),与数据库中的表对应。
2. 创建数据访问对象(Repository),使用Spring Data JPA简化数据库操作。
3. 编写服务层(Service)逻辑,处理业务需求。
4. 实现控制层(Controller),处理HTTP请求,并将请求分发到服务层。
5. 设计视图层(View),使用Thymeleaf或JSP展示数据。
6. 配置Spring Security进行用户认证和授权。
系统部署:
1. 配置application.properties或application.yml文件,设置服务端口、数据库连接等。
2. 使用IDE或命令行打包应用为可执行的JAR或WAR文件。
3. 在服务器上部署应用,如果是使用Spring Boot内置服务器,直接运行JAR文件即可。
4. 检查系统日志,确保应用正确运行,没有错误信息。
5. 进行功能测试,确保所有模块按预期工作。
通过以上步骤,你可以构建一个基本的智慧党建系统。然而,系统的优化、性能调优、安全加固等高级主题不在上述范围内,需要更深入的学习和实践。建议在完成基础构建后,继续通过《Springboot和Mysql实现的智慧党建系统源码教程》深入学习,以获得更全面的知识和技能。
参考资源链接:[Springboot和Mysql实现的智慧党建系统源码教程](https://wenku.csdn.net/doc/7dsm44j0jx?spm=1055.2569.3001.10343)
阅读全文